An excellent opportunity for a graduating fellow or established clinician to join our team at UPMC Mercy Hospital as a clinician educator and to direct our Antimicrobial Stewardship program. UPMC Mercy is a 495-bed hospital with an adjacent hospital which is being built for Rehabilitation medicine and Ophthalmology.
The hospital is located in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, a city which continues to rank high as one of the most “livable cities” in the United States. This exceptional opportunity as a Clinical Assistant Professor will include inpatient/outpatient care and teaching of medical residents. A highly competitive benefits package with exceptional compensation and incentives will be offered. Candidates should be board certified or eligible in Infectious Diseases, have an interest in Antimicrobial Stewardship and have a strong commitment to clinical medicine and education.
